
帮忙看看哪个地方出错了,改了好久还是没有成功,不知道哪个地方的问题。
结合GPT的建议:这个错误提示表明在运行你的Python代码时出现了问题,主要是关于使用xlwings
库读取Excel文件的部分。根据错误信息,问题似乎出现在以下几个地方:
- 第 14 行,调用了
read_data
函数,该函数似乎涉及到使用xlwings
库来读取 Excel 文件。 - 该代码似乎在一个名为“生成图片.py”的文件中,位于路径
C:\Users\Lenovo\Desktop\论文\学习者画像程序\
。 - 错误信息中提到了 COM 对象的问题,这通常涉及到 Windows 操作系统的组件。
根据错误信息,似乎出现了一些与 Excel 或 COM 对象交互的问题。以下是一些可能的解决方法:
确保路径正确:确保在代码中提供的文件路径是正确的,并且文件实际上存在于指定路径中。
安装 xlwings:确认你已经正确安装了 xlwings
库。你可以使用以下命令来安装它:
pip install xlwings
检查 Excel 文件:确认你尝试打开的 Excel 文件("数据.xlsx")没有被其他程序锁定,而且它是一个有效的 Excel 文件。
更新 COM 组件:有时候 COM 组件可能会出现问题。尝试更新你的 Windows 操作系统以及相关的 Microsoft Office 组件。
尝试可视化运行:根据错误信息,你的代码似乎在创建 xlwings
应用程序对象时设置了 visible=False
,这意味着 Excel 实例是不可见的。尝试将 visible
参数设置为 True
,以便在运行时可以看到 Excel 实例,这有助于排除问题。
如果你尝试了以上解决方法但问题仍然存在,可能需要更多的上下文信息才能提供更精确的帮助。你可以提供更多代码片段以及代码的上下文信息,这有助于更好地理解问题并提供更准确的解决方案。
【相关推荐】
- 这个问题的回答你可以参考下: https://ask.csdn.net/questions/7604386
- 我还给你找了一篇非常好的博客,你可以看看是否有帮助,链接:(Python基础习题)给出一个整数数组,请在数组中找出两个加起来等于目标函数的数。
- 同时,你还可以查看手册:python- 格式化字符串字面值 中的内容
- 您还可以看一下 jeevan老师的Python量化交易,大操手量化投资系列课程之内功修炼篇课程中的 基础编程之股票行情构造小节, 巩固相关知识点
- 除此之外, 这篇博客: python中的变量中的 变量名再次出现的时候,不是定义变量,而是直接使用之前定义的变量。 部分也许能够解决你的问题, 你可以仔细阅读以下内容或跳转源博客中阅读:
买水果
水果的价格是8.5元/斤
买了7.5斤水果
计算付款金额
只要买水果,就返5块钱

名字要:见名知意
可以由字母,下划线和数字组成
不能以数字开头
不能和关键字重明
驼峰命名法
1.大驼峰:每一个单词的首字母都大写
FirstName LastName
2.小驼峰:第一个单词以小写字母开始,后续单词的首字母大写
firstName lastName






1、在python中可以使用print函数将信息输出到控制台
如果希望输出文字信息的同时,一起输出数据,就需要使用到格式化操作符
% 被称为格式化操作符,专门用于处理字符串中的格式
包含%的字符串,被称为格式化字符串
% 和不同的字符连用,不同类型的数据需要使用不同的格式化字符
2、格式化字符串的含义
%s 格式化字符串
%d 有符号十进制整数,%06d表示输出的整数显示位数字,不足的地方使用0补全
%f 浮点数,%.02f表示小数点后只显示两位
%% 输出%
3、语法格式:
print '格式化字符串' % 变量1
print '格式化字符串' % (变量1,变量2...)
# 用格式化字符串把需要填写变量的地方先占上
如果你已经解决了该问题, 非常希望你能够分享一下解决方案, 写成博客, 将相关链接放在评论区, 以帮助更多的人 ^-^